1

Super Affiliate System John Crestani for Dummies

News Discuss 
Super Affiliate System is very best for people who find themselves absolutely new to affiliate advertising and marketing. The training course does a terrific work of going for walks persons by the entire process of setting up an affiliate company from A to Z. The videos are easy to https://super-affiliate-system65307.59bloggers.com/31958632/super-affiliate-system-john-crestani-no-further-a-mystery

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story